QUADRO RIPORTATO

A ceilingfrescomade to look like framed easel paintings that have been attached to thevaultwith figures appearing to be viewed at normal eye level. TheFarnese ceiling(c. 1597-1600) in thePalazzo Farnese, Rome, andGuido Reni'sAurora(1613; Rome, Casino Rospigliosi) utilize this technique.
